Firming up your Technique

1. Initiate the stroke by pushing with your legs and leaning slightly backward.
2. Now, pull the handle toward your lower ribs.
3. Release by smoothly sliding the seat under your body and extending your arms forward.

Helpful Tips for a Thriving Workout

Is your blood pumping already? Here are some tips to help you leverage the most out of your Concept 2 Rowing Machine.

1. Maintain a relaxed grip on the handlebars; over gripping may lead to tension in your forearms and shoulders.
2. Keep your back straight throughout the rowing motion.
3. Your legs should do most of the work, accounting for about 60% of the power.
